What Causes the Door Lock to Repeatedly Pop Open Automatically?
1 Answers
There are several reasons why a car door lock may repeatedly pop open automatically: 1. Remote signal interference: In such cases, it is advisable to visit a repair shop for inspection and repair. Additionally, some vehicles with anti-explosion sun films applied to the front windshield may experience unresponsive remote door locks when attempting to unlock the car from the front. This occurs because the anti-explosion sun film can partially block the remote signal. 2. Strong magnetic field signals: When using smart remote keys, avoid exposure to strong magnetic fields, such as high-voltage power lines or transmission towers. Parking in areas with strong magnetic fields should be avoided, as smart keys operate using low-intensity radio waves and may malfunction under magnetic interference. 3. Poor battery contact: Avoid dropping or throwing the smart key, as although most smart key casings are durable, frequent impacts can lead to poor internal battery contact.
